lang/fennel: Update to 1.2.1

https://git.sr.ht/~technomancy/fennel/tree/main/item/changelog.md#121--2022-10-15

Sponsored by:	The FreeBSD Foundation
This commit is contained in:
Joseph Mingrone 2022-12-12 15:41:33 -04:00
parent b270bac55f
commit 40b230a1d7
No known key found for this signature in database
GPG Key ID: 36A40C83B0D6EF9E
3 changed files with 28 additions and 6 deletions

View File

@ -1,5 +1,5 @@
PORTNAME= fennel
DISTVERSION= 1.2.0
DISTVERSION= 1.2.1
CATEGORIES= lang
MASTER_SITES= https://git.sr.ht/~technomancy/${PORTNAME}/archive/${DISTVERSION}${EXTRACT_SUFX}?dummy=/
@ -10,7 +10,7 @@ WWW= https://fennel-lang.org/
LICENSE= MIT
LICENSE_FILE= ${WRKSRC}/LICENSE
USES= gmake lua:build
USES= gmake lua:51+
MAKE_ENV= DESTDIR=${STAGEDIR} \
LUA=${LUA_CMD} \
@ -25,4 +25,10 @@ TEST_TARGET= test
NO_ARCH= yes
OPTIONS_DEFINE= DOCS
do-install-DOCS-on:
${MKDIR} ${STAGEDIR}${DOCSDIR}
${INSTALL_MAN} ${WRKSRC}/*.md ${STAGEDIR}${DOCSDIR}
.include <bsd.port.mk>

View File

@ -1,3 +1,3 @@
TIMESTAMP = 1665091820
SHA256 (fennel-1.2.0.tar.gz) = 203bd7f365f1805e063fbca4876b4c0d04f3b4ac47d967a9d43d9766c2de4e55
SIZE (fennel-1.2.0.tar.gz) = 270255
TIMESTAMP = 1670864299
SHA256 (fennel-1.2.1.tar.gz) = 6654aadb7659bbf88d3879190392573e1ae39087eaaf5084e95f45db8e82ad51
SIZE (fennel-1.2.1.tar.gz) = 271590

View File

@ -1,3 +1,19 @@
bin/fennel
%%LUA_MODSHAREDIR%%/fennel.lua
man/man1/fennel.1.gz
%%PORTDOCS%%%%DOCSDIR%%/CODE-OF-CONDUCT.md
%%PORTDOCS%%%%DOCSDIR%%/CONTRIBUTING.md
%%PORTDOCS%%%%DOCSDIR%%/README.md
%%PORTDOCS%%%%DOCSDIR%%/api.md
%%PORTDOCS%%%%DOCSDIR%%/changelog.md
%%PORTDOCS%%%%DOCSDIR%%/from-clojure.md
%%PORTDOCS%%%%DOCSDIR%%/lua-primer.md
%%PORTDOCS%%%%DOCSDIR%%/macros.md
%%PORTDOCS%%%%DOCSDIR%%/rationale.md
%%PORTDOCS%%%%DOCSDIR%%/reference.md
%%PORTDOCS%%%%DOCSDIR%%/release-checklist.md
%%PORTDOCS%%%%DOCSDIR%%/security.md
%%PORTDOCS%%%%DOCSDIR%%/setup.md
%%PORTDOCS%%%%DOCSDIR%%/style.md
%%PORTDOCS%%%%DOCSDIR%%/tutorial.md
%%PORTDOCS%%%%DOCSDIR%%/values.md
%%LUA_MODSHAREDIR%%/fennel.lua